Pushing a metal skewer into a cake is a test to see if the cake has been cooked thoroughly. The skewer should be clean when pulled out. If cake ingredients is sticking to the skewer, it means it is still not cooked in the middle.
To skewer meat effectively during a barbecue session, a trainer may use techniques such as properly threading the meat onto the skewer, ensuring even distribution of meat on the skewer, and adjusting the cooking temperature and time to prevent overcooking or undercooking. Additionally, using marinades or seasonings can enhance the flavor of the meat while it cooks on the skewer.
